About Buou UI

BuouUI is a TailwindCSS UI library that provides a collection of ready-to-copy-and-paste components, sections, landing pages, and templates for building websites. The platform offers a variety of UI categories including Application UI, Marketing UI, Brutal UI, and Bento Grid components, along with a calendar component and a Supa Starter Kit for creating custom UI libraries, Notion-like apps, or AI applications. It is designed to streamline web development by offering pre-built, customizable elements that can be directly integrated into projects.

The library appears to target developers and designers who want to accelerate their workflow with smooth, high-end UI components. Testimonials from users at companies like Tencent, Huawei, and Alibaba suggest it is used in professional settings. The platform also offers a paid plan called "SupaUI MCP" for unlimited use at $9.9 per month, while basic access appears to be free with options to join a newsletter for updates.

BuouUI emphasizes ease of use, with a focus on copy-paste integration and a wide range of components for both application and marketing needs. The website showcases animations and a calendar feature, indicating a modern, interactive design approach. Pricing is listed as "contact" for bundles, suggesting enterprise or custom pricing options are available beyond the monthly subscription.

FAQ

Is BuouUI free to use?
Based on available information, BuouUI appears to offer free access to some components, with a paid SupaUI MCP plan for unlimited use at $9.9 per month. Full bundle pricing requires contacting the team, so exact free tier limits should be verified on the website.
What frameworks does BuouUI support?
BuouUI is built with TailwindCSS, so it is compatible with any project that uses TailwindCSS. The components are designed to be copy-pasted directly into your codebase.
Can I use BuouUI for commercial projects?
The website does not explicitly state licensing terms for commercial use. It is recommended to review the terms of service or contact BuouUI directly to confirm usage rights for commercial projects.
What types of components are included?
BuouUI includes Application UI components (forms, tables, modals), Marketing UI components (cards, animations), Brutal UI components (retro style), Bento Grid layouts, and a calendar component. It also offers landing pages and templates.
